1. Budgeting Basics: Crafting a Travel Savings Plan

To start your journey toward affordable travel, establishing a clear budget is essential. Begin by determining your overall travel costs, including transportation, accommodation, meals, activities, and souvenirs. Create a separate savings account dedicated to travel expenses and set a realistic monthly contribution goal. Having a visual representation of your progress, such as a savings chart or app, can help keep you motivated and on track.

Next, prioritize your travel goals. Are you looking to visit multiple destinations, or do you prefer an immersive experience in a single location? Understanding your travel preferences will help you allocate funds more efficiently. Research average costs for your intended destinations to develop a more accurate budget. This will help you identify areas where you can cut back, whether it be reducing the length of your trip or choosing less touristy attractions.

Finally, always leave room for unexpected expenses in your budget. Travel can often come with surprises, from flight delays to unplanned excursions. Setting aside a small emergency fund will provide peace of mind and ensure you can enjoy your travel experience without financial stress.

2. Choosing Accommodations: Affordable Options and Tips

When it comes to finding affordable accommodations, flexibility is key. Consider alternatives to traditional hotels, such as hostels, vacation rentals, or even house-swapping. Websites like Airbnb and Hostelworld offer various options to suit different budgets, allowing for unique experiences that can enhance your travel adventure. Additionally, staying outside of tourist hotspots can significantly reduce accommodation costs while providing an authentic local experience.

Don’t forget to take advantage of loyalty programs and discounts. Many hotel chains offer points that can be redeemed for free nights or upgrades. Additionally, student, military, or senior discounts may apply, so it’s worth inquiring before booking. If possible, travel during the off-peak season to find lower rates and enjoy fewer crowds.

Consider the amenities that come with your accommodation. While a cheaper place might save you money upfront, it may lack essential amenities like breakfast, Wi-Fi, or free parking. Calculating the total cost of your stay, including these factors, will help you make a well-informed decision that aligns with your budget.

3. Smart Transportation: Cost-Effective Travel Solutions

Getting around your destination can quickly eat into your travel budget, but there are multiple ways to save on transportation. Public transportation is often the most economical option, with buses, trams, and subways providing affordable access to various attractions. Research transit passes for unlimited travel within certain timeframes, which can save you money if you plan to explore extensively.

Car rentals can also be a considerable expense, so evaluate if it’s necessary. Instead, consider ride-sharing services or local taxis for shorter distances. If you’re traveling in a group, splitting the cost of a rental car might be a better option. Always compare prices across different platforms to ensure you’re getting the best deal.

Lastly, consider walking or biking to explore your destination. Not only is this a free option, but it also allows you to discover hidden gems and experience the local culture up close. Many cities offer bike-sharing programs that provide an affordable and fun way to get around while staying active.

4. Dining Wisely: Eating Well on a Budget While Traveling

Dining out can be one of the most enjoyable aspects of travel, but it can also be a significant budget drain if not managed wisely. Start by researching local eateries, food markets, and street food vendors, which often provide authentic meals at a fraction of the cost of tourist-oriented restaurants. This not only saves money but also gives you a unique taste of local culture and cuisine.

Consider cooking some of your meals if your accommodation allows it. Grocery stores often offer fresh, local ingredients at lower prices than dining out. Preparing a few simple meals can save you substantial money, allowing you to indulge in a few special dining experiences without guilt. Also, packing snacks for day trips can curb unnecessary spending on overpriced convenience foods.

Lastly, take advantage of lunch specials and happy hour deals. Many restaurants offer discounted menus during lunchtime or specific hours of the day. This not only allows you to enjoy delicious meals on a budget but also provides an opportunity to try various local dishes without overspending.
